From fd80df352ba1884ce2b62dd8d9495582308101b7 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Charles Keepax Date: Mon, 17 Feb 2025 14:01:56 +0000 Subject: regcache: Add support for sorting defaults arrays The defaults array in regcache must be sorted into ascending register address order, because binary search is used to locate values in the array. Add a helper to sort the register defaults array which can be useful for systems that dynamically create a defaults array based on external information.
